SanDisk signs Salam Studios and Stores as official distributor in Qatar; recognizes contribution by Digital Technologies in Lebanon
Dubai - June 2nd, 2010: SanDisk® Corporation (NASDAQ: SNDK), the inventor and world's largest supplier of flash storage cards, today announced signing a distributorship agreement with Salam Studios and Stores covering Qatar.
Research reports state that mobile penetration in Qatar currently exceeds 100 percent and is forecasted to exceed 210 percent by 2014. Further, mobile handset sales in Qatar are expected to total AED 297 million (QR295 million) by 2014.
Lebanon is also on an impressive growth path with its mobile subscriber base recorded to have touched the 40,000 mark in 2009 and just Blackberry users would reach the 30,000 mark by the end of 2011.
"Qatar and Lebanon are growth markets for us and our partners have helped us achieve our targets. We are very excited to sign on Salam Studios as our official distributor in Qatar and at the same time, applaud the efforts of Digital Technologies, our partner in Lebanon," said Tareq Husseini, SanDisk's Middle East and Africa Sales Director.
Both distributors work closely with SanDisk to promote, support, market and distribute the products. SanDisk products are available in Qatar and Lebanon through a wide range of retail outlets. This agreement is pursuant to SanDisk plans for more aggressive expansion of its new products as well as other flash memory cards.

About SanDisk
SanDisk Corporation is the global leader in flash memory cards, from research, manufacturing and product design to consumer branding and retail distribution. SanDisk's product portfolio includes flash memory cards for mobile phones, digital cameras and camcorders; digital audio/video players; USB flash drives for consumers and the enterprise; embedded memory for mobile devices; and solid state drives for computers. SanDisk is a Silicon Valley-based S&P 500 company, with more than half its sales outside the United States.
